Randeep Surjewala Reviews Karnataka Ministers Amid Complaint Discussions

IO_AdminAfrica12 hours ago7 Views

Quick Summary

  • Leadership tussle between Karnataka Chief Minister Siddaramaiah and Deputy CM D.K. Shivakumar persists.
  • AICC General Secretary Randeep Singh Surjewala visited key Cabinet Ministers to address grievances raised during prior meetings with Congress legislators.
  • Surjewala met Housing Minister B.Z.Zameer Ahmed Khan, Urban Progress Minister Byrathi Suresh, and Social Welfare Minister H.C. Mahadevappa on Monday.
  • Legislators had reportedly raised issues regarding lack of development funding and inaccessibility of Ministers during earlier feedback sessions with Surjewala.
  • zameer Ahmed Khan denied allegations of corruption in housing allotment being discussed but said housing needs for constituencies were reviewed instead; he expressed satisfaction at receiving praise from Surjewala for his department’s performance.
  • Education Minister Madhu Bangarappa is also set to meet Surjewala as part of an OBC cell review initiative evaluating party wing performance statewide.
  • The exercise aims to gather inputs from all Karnataka Congress leaders before submission to Rahul Gandhi and Mallikarjun Kharge.
  • Cooperation Minister K.N. Rajanna (aligned with the CM) criticized the outreach initiative, reflecting broader dissatisfaction within Siddaramaiah’s camp regarding this process.

Indian Opinion Analysis
Surjewala’s outreach programme highlights internal tensions within Karnataka’s Congress leadership, underscoring challenges in resolving governance complaints amid factional disagreements between camps loyal to Chief Minister Siddaramaiah and Deputy CM D.K shivakumar.While efforts like grievance redressal directly from central leadership represent effective accountability measures,resistance from influential state-level figures might complicate party cohesion ahead of major governance agendas or electoral strategies.

The reported issues-such as inadequate funding for development works or perceived inaccessibility among certain ministers-could affect both public perception and administrative efficacy if left unchecked over time. Though, centrally organized reviews offer a potential avenue for resolution while reinforcing intra-party dialogue channels vital at a state level presently navigating complex dynamics post-election. How effectively this consultative approach preserves unity may have implications across both governance priorities within Karnataka and broader electoral calculations by the national leadership looking forward.
